LXADOZ104's EASY UPGRADE PROCESS TO IRTEHUN'S TOUR HYBRID O/S
STEP 1: LOAD/RESTORE BASE 4.7 O/S
- simply reinstall (or install for the first time) the base manufacturer O/S. If you've already installed, simply reinstall and choose "repair"
STEP 2: DOWNLOAD IRTEHUN HYBRID O/S, INSTALL/EXTRACT
- I use the .rar and extract files to a temp folder and then copy over base files. The installer will do this for you automatically.
STEP 3: RUN SHRINK-A-OS
- If you use installer, Irtehun's Hybrid will place the .exe in the base folder as follows:
C:\Program Files\Common Files\Research In Motion\Shared\Loader Files\9630-v4.7.1.40_P4.1.0.40
- Simply run this and select what you do not want to install
- I recommend all language files, remove AIM, Flickr, ICQ, MSN, Yahoo, Default Backgrounds, Help Files, Setup Wizard, TTY, VCAST, Vodaphone, VZNavigator.
- After the Shrink, the OS is ~44.37MB.
- All the files removed are placed in a folder created by Shrink-A-OS here:
C:\Program Files\Common Files\Research In Motion\Shared\Loader Files\9630-v4.7.1.40_P4.1.0.40\Java\RemovedFiles
- I manually remove the following files that are not caught by Shrink-A-OS:
net_rim_bb_medialoader_video_9630_480x360.cod (6678KB)
net_rim_vad_engine_resource__es_MX.cod (504KB)
net_rim_vad_engine_resource__fr_CA.cod (476KB)
- New size of OS install (JAVA folder) 36.90MB
STEP 4: RUN LOADER.EXE (FROM SHRINK-A-OS)
- This will install the changed files
- Make sure and check to back-up and restore applications and settings/etc.
- NOTE that this step takes 15-30 minutes depending on amount of data to restore (15 minutes just for the load of updated files, another 15 minutes to restore the back-up created as part of the loader process.
STEP 5: RECONNECT TO DESKTOP MANAGER - this step ensures your mail settings are transferred
STEP 6: POWER DEVICE / VALIDATE INSTALL / REBOOT
- it may take a day to work out delays/etc., don't get too worked up, but it's important to note here what applications you are having problems with.
OPTIONAL STEPS (may or may not be necessary, really depends on a variety of issues)
A. Resend service books for BIS accounts
B. *228 (PRL Update)
C. Reboots (multiple times)
D. Re-setup software (license/legal/etc. agreements)
Having done the wipe-method using JL_Cmder tonight, this is my preferred approach. Here is the process for doing a complete wipe. This also assumes you have your device on a BES, as I do, as such, I don't restore from a back-up.
LXADOZ104'S PREFERRED UPGRADE PROCESS TO IRTEHUN TOUR O/S HYBRID:
STEPS 1-3: SAME AS ABOVE
STEP 4: BACK-UP DEVICE FULLY
- connect your device to the computer, run desktop manager, and do a full back-up. Add something to the back-up (.ipd) file that reminds you this back-up is a pre-upgrade back-up.
- NOTE: I only restore messages...personal preference. See restore step below
STEP 5: RUN JL_CDMER TO WIPE DEVICE
- I suggest you follow this guide for instructions on this (it's what I did):
http://forums.crackberry.com/f3/how-...l_cmder-53502/
STEP 6: LOAD O/S VIA DESKTOP MANAGER
- Click on Application Loader
- Choose Update Software
- NOTE: If you are connected to the internet, you'll get two choices, the "preferred" choice is the base O/S, do not select this option. Even better, don't have your computer connected to the internet. This step may confuse you, but just make sure you select the "LOCAL" device software on your computer. This is the version that you have modified and shrunk
STEP 7: TURN ON DEVICE/RADIO, RE-ACTIVATE WITH BES
- My BES typically stores some settings, so I let this occur completely
STEP 8: RESTORE MESSAGES/APPS/ETC. VIA DESKTOP MANAGER
- I go to "BACKUP/RESTORE" option and choose "ADVANCED". I only restore messages so I have copies of e-mails that won't be resent by BES. All other PIM data is restored via activation, and I prefer to reinstall applications.
STEP 9: REINSTALL OTA APPLICATIONS AS NEEDED
- hey, why not enjoy your Rev. A device and the speed of installing software!
FINAL NOTES: GIVE THE DEVICE A FULL DAY TO "NORMALIZE"
- it just seems that the device takes some time to get normal. After an upgrade, you may have a lag here and there, but unless the device is completely locking up, or unusable, don't worry - it will work itself out.
